.. include:: /shortcuts.rstext .. index:: pair: Block category; Personal info Personal info --------------- The artefact blocks in this tab allow you to include information that you provided in the :ref:`profile ` into your portfolio. If you want to make changes to the text or the images, go to *Content → Profile*. There is no further configuration possible. .. index:: pair: Blocks; My groups single: Personal info block; My groups single: New in Mahara 1.10; Sort groups in the "My groups" block single: New in Mahara 1.10; Limit number of groups in the "My groups" block" .. _groups_block: My groups 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 .. image:: /images/page_editor/blocks/mygroups_chooser.* :alt: Add the groups block Add a block that displays your groups on your profile page. It is a standard profile page block. |new in Mahara 1.10| You can decide on the sort order of the groups and also limit the number of groups to be shown before a paginator is displayed. .. figure:: /images/page_editor/blocks/mygroups_configure.* :alt: Configure the block My groups Configure the *My groups* block #. **Sort groups**: Decide in which sort order your groups should be displayed: * Most recently joined: Groups are displayed in chronologically reverse order to show the groups that you joined recently first. * Earliest joined: This option displays your groups in the order in which you joined them. * A to Z: Alphabetically from A to Z. This is the default option. #. **Maximum number of groups to display**: Decide how many groups you wish to display in the block before the paginator is shown and the remaining pages can be seen on the next page within the block. Leave this field empty if you wish to display all your groups. #. **Retractable**: Tick this checkbox if you want to allow users to reduce the block to its heading on a page. The user can click the *Retractable* icon |retractable| to just show the heading. #. **Automatically retract**: Tick this checkbox if you want to show only the block's heading when a user views the page. The user can click the *Retracted* icon |retracted| to view the entire block. #. Click the *Save* button to accept your changes, or click the *Cancel* button to leave the block's content as it is. The *Remove* button is shown only when you place the block into the page for the first time. #. You can also click the *Close* button |close| in the top right-hand corner to either remove a newly created block before it is being saved or to cancel any changes and leave the block's content as it is. .. index:: pair: Blocks; My pages single: Personal info block; My pages .. _pages_block: My pages 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 .. image:: /images/page_editor/blocks/myviews_chooser.* :alt: Add the pages block Add a block that displays your pages on your profile page. Other users can leave messages for you, i.e. write on your wall, and they can decide whether everyone looking at your profile page can see them or only they and you. You only need to place the block on your profile page. There is no further configuration possible. When you view your wall (or someone else's wall) on your profile page, you see the following. .. figure:: /images/page_editor/blocks/wall_view.* :alt: A wall on a profile page A wall on a profile page #. Enter your message in the text box. You can use BBCode to format your message. .. note:: BBCode gives you a way to include formatting like bold or italics in your messages. For example, to make a word bold, you would write it like this: [b]hello[/b]. In your message, the word will show up as hello. The BBCode markers - the [b] and [/b] - disappear. The following BBCodes are available: * **[b]** and **[/b]** to make words bold - e.g. [b]ponies[/b]. * **[i]** and **[/i]** to make words italic - e.g. [i]amazing![/i]. * **[img]** and **[/img]** to insert an image - e.g. [img]http://mahara.org/favicon.ico[/img] * **[url]** and **[/url]** to insert a link - e.g. [url]http://google.co.nz[/url] or [url=http://google.co.nz/]Google[/url] Links in your message are automatically clickable. #. **Make your post private**: Decide who shall see your wall post. If you make it private, only you and the person to whose wall you are posting will see the post. #. Click the *Post* button to add your message to the wall. #. A wall post always contains the name of the person who made the post, the date and the actual message. Wall posts that ae private are highlighted in a special color / pattern. In the default theme it red stripes. #. A public wall post can be viewed by anyone who has access to the profile page. #. Click the *Delete* button |delete| if you do not want to have a specific post on your wall. The post authors and you as owner of your wall can delete posts. #. Click the *View whole wall* link to see older wall posts. Résumé ~~~~~~~~~~ You can display either your entire résumé or parts of it in any portfolio page.
